>> There is a "php_mapscript.so" in 
>> "/usr/local/php5cgi/lib/php/extensions/no-debug-non-zts-20090626". I added 
>> "extension = php_mapscript.so" to php.ini, as well as "extension_dir = 
>> "/usr/local/php5cgi/lib/php/extensions"".
> 
> No need to set extension_dir, it defaults to the correct dir, which is not as 
> you set it but includes the no-debug... subdir.
> 
>> Restarted the server, "sudo /usr/sbin/apachectl restart".
> 
> graceful is all that's needed: sudo apachectl graceful, but it probably 
> doesn't matter.
